About the Role
Couriers provide efficient pick-up and delivery services to customers, ensuring compliance with all operational, security, and safety policies. They are a critical component of customer service, aiming to meet service commitments and maximize customer satisfaction while maintaining confidentiality and promoting the organization's mission and philosophy.
Responsibilities
- Pick up and deliver items including vaccines, mail, supplies, lab specimens, and bank deposits to assigned locations in a timely manner.
- Drive a defined pick-up and delivery route as scheduled.
- Ensure vaccine and lab deliveries are kept in coolers at the proper temperature and document vaccine deliveries.
- Ensure bank deposits are signed for and delivered to the bank according to company policy and schedule.
- Obey all traffic laws and follow safe traffic and transportation procedures.
- Maintain an on-time delivery schedule while handling occasional STAT requests.
- Maintain professionalism in all interactions, including language, attire, and demeanor.
- Maintain cleanliness and order in the work area and company vehicles.
- Perform routine maintenance on company vehicles, such as oil changes and tire rotations.
- Notify supervisor of vehicle repair needs.
- Adhere to all company policies, including OSHA, HIPAA, compliance, and Code of Conduct.
